    The Civil War in Sierra Leone I. Introduction Between 1991 and 2002‚ Sierra Leone was heavily damaged by a tremendously violent civil war. This civil war erupted because of the mounting dissatisfaction of the people‚ especially the youth that were engrossed by the rebellious Revolutionary United Front (RUF)‚ towards the politics of the country that was set apart by its corruption‚ negligence and electoral violence.     "The Sniper‚" a story about the Irish civil war‚ was Liam O’Flaherty’s first published piece of fiction. It appeared in 1923 in the London publication The New Leader. Over the years‚ it has been reprinted several times‚ and as of 2004 it could be found in O’Flaherty’s Collected Stories. "The Sniper" helped set O’Flaherty firmly on the writer’s path.
